Abstract
The high-efficiency, broad-spectrum, safe and low-pollution compounded fungicide with specific effect for preventing and curing several diseases of crops, forest, fruit tree and vegetables is formed from diethofencarb and carbendazim, and can be made into smoke preparation, suspension preparation, suspension concentrate, wates emulsion and microemulsin, etc..

The mould prestige carbendazim of embodiment 1:25% second fumicants
Get former medicine 5 grams of the mould prestige of second, carbendazim active compound 20 grams, sawmilling 16 grams, ammonium nitrate 34 grams, ammonium chloride 22.5 grams, ammonium thiocyanate 2.5 grams.
Processing method: above-mentioned raw materials is mixed, mix through pulverizing (40 order), packing is the powdery fumicants.Inserting in fumicants during use ignites to twist with the fingers lights, gray mold, early blight, powdery mildew, downy mildew on the control protection ground vegetables.Every mu with fumicants 200~300 gram, and effect reaches more than 90%.
Embodiment 2:20% probenazole chlorothalonil smoke
Get former medicine 2 grams of probenazole, former medicine 18 grams of tpn, wood powder 16 grams, potassium chlorate 18 grams, potter's clay 30 grams, ammonium chloride 16 grams.
Processing method: potassium chlorate pulverized separately and by 80 mesh sieves, the pulverizing (80 order) that mixes of all the other raw materials, the potassium chlorate after will pulverizing again mixes, add suitable quantity of water after, mixing, moulding, oven dry smoked sheet.Light gray mold, downy mildew, powdery mildew, early blight, late blight on the control protection ground vegetables during use with fire.Every mu with fumicants 200~300 gram, and effect reaches more than 90%.
Embodiment 3:40% vinclozolin frost urea cyanogen suspending agent
Get vinclozolin 25 grams, white urea cyanogen 15 grams, 1656H 2 grams, M-95 gram, white carbon 3 grams, CMC2 gram, ethylene glycol 5 grams, water 43 grams.
Processing method: above-mentioned raw materials is mixed, and through ball milling (200 order), sand milling becomes 3~5 microns of average grain diameters.Gray mildew, early blight, late blight, downy mildew on control protection ground and the land for growing field crops vegetables.Every mu of usefulness 50~100 is restrained agent, and effect reaches more than 90%.
Embodiment 4:25% iprodione triazolone suspended emulsion
Get former medicine 15 grams of iprodione, former medicine 10 grams of triazolone, 1656H 5 grams, M-95 gram, white carbon 3 grams, CMC 2 grams, cyclohexanone 10 grams, ethylene glycol 3 grams, water 37 grams.
Processing method: the former medicine of triazolone, 1656H, cyclohexanone are mixed, mix with other raw material after the stirring and dissolving again, through ball milling (200 order), sand milling is made 3~5 microns of average grain diameters.Control vegetables, melon, beans gray mold, powdery mildew, early blight, rust.Every mu with preparation 100~150 gram, and effect reaches more than 90%.
Embodiment 5:15% dimethachlon triazolone aqueous emulsion
Get former medicine 5 grams of dimethachlon, former medicine 10 grams of triazolone, toluene 30 grams, 1656H 5 grams, n-butanol 2 grams, ethylene glycol 2 grams, CMC 1 gram, soft water 45 grams.
Processing method: dimethachlon triazolone, toluene, 1656H, n-butanol are put into pot, make oil phase behind the stirring and evenly mixing, ethylene glycol, CMC and soft water are put into the pot stirring and evenly mixing make water.Under high-speed stirred, oil phase is added aqueous phase, finely disseminated aqueous emulsion.Prevent and treat powdery mildew of wheat and barley, rust, vegetables, melon and fruit class gray mold, powdery mildew.Every mu with preparation 100~200 gram, and effect reaches more than 90%.
